Luminous Output

The listed luminous efficiency is approximately 150 lumens per watt.

Based on a 1,600W total load, the theoretical luminous output is approximately 240,000 lumens. However, this calculation may represent raw LED-chip output rather than complete fixture output.

Confirm whether the published lumen value is:

  • Raw LED output
  • Initial fixture output
  • Maintained fixture output
  • Total output from all four lamps
  • Measured under standard laboratory conditions

Verified lux readings at specific distances should also be provided.

Stabilizing Supports

Support legs or outriggers are used to stabilize the tower before the mast is raised.

The final specification should state:

  • Number of supports
  • Extension range
  • Adjustment method
  • Footpad dimensions
  • Maximum permitted ground slope
  • Levelling procedure
  • Required deployment sequence

The mast should remain lowered until the machine is stable and level.

Rated LED Lifetime

The LED system is listed with a working life of approximately 50,000 hours.

This should be described as an estimated rated lifetime under specified operating conditions.

Actual service life depends on:

  • Driver quality
  • Thermal management
  • Ambient temperature
  • Voltage stability
  • Dust and moisture exposure
  • Operating schedule
  • Maintenance

Important Safety Information

Only trained personnel should transport, deploy, operate, refuel, charge, or service the mobile lighting tower.

Fully extend and level the stabilizing supports before raising the mast.

Do not operate the mast above the verified wind-speed limit.

Keep the tower away from overhead electrical lines and maintain all required clearance distances.

Inspect the lamps, mast, cables, fuel system, battery, generator, trailer, tyres, controls, and support legs before each use.
